About this role

Job summary The Redbridge Stroke and Neuro Service provides multidisciplinary assessment and rehabilitation for Redbridge residents within their own homes. Assessing individuals in their home environment enables the team to deliver person-centred interventions that significantly improve quality of life and promote independence. Through the provision of specialist therapy and close collaboration with social services, physiotherapists, and other members of the integrated multidisciplinary team, the service supports individuals in achieving their rehabilitation goals and maximising their functional abilities. This collaborative approach makes the role both rewarding and impactful, offering the opportunity to make a meaningful difference to the lives of people recovering from stroke and neurological conditions.

The role will require the successful candidate to work as part of multi-disciplinary team using current evidence-based therapy techniques & provide thorough Neuro Assessments. The candidate will also need to engage with other health & social care colleagues both internally and externally.

Staff are expected to be able to work across all NELFT sites

Main duties of the job Main duties of the job

Specialist community stroke and neuro assessment in homes Establish and evaluate appropriate treatment plans Equipment provision Work as part of a Multidisciplinary Team Supervision of Band 3 & 4 Rehabilitation Assistants Deputising for the Band 7 Team Leads To support Pre registration students Deliver day-to-day patient care, administrative support, data entry. Liaise with internal and external stakeholders to support service delivery. Maintain accurate records and ensure compliance with Trust policies. Participate in team meetings and contribute to service improvement initiatives.

Starting with NELFT

NELFT place a great deal of importance on new starters being properly welcomed and inducted into the Trust. All new starters will join the Trust on the first Monday of each month and will undertake a comprehensive induction of up to two weeks which will include mandatory training, systems training and the allocation of equipment. As part of the process new starters will have the opportunity to also meet the executive team, senior managers and attend a number of drop-in sessions focusing on engagement, health and wellbeing and key processes. The induction will be held at our head office in Goodmayes Hospital.

Probationary Period

This post will be subject to a probationary period. Internal applicants are exempt from the probationary period (unless you are an internal applicant currently part way through a probationary period or currently a bank member of staff).

High-Cost Area Supplement

This post also attracts payment for High-Cost Area Supplement of 15% of the basic salary (minimum payment of £4,870 and a maximum payment of £6,137) pro rata for part time staff.
